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Ormskirk to Alderley Edge start from £29.20 one way, or £29.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ormskirk to Alderley Edge are available for £29.20 one way, or £29.70 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Ticketing at Ormskirk Station

Ormskirk station prides itself on offering comprehensive amenities aimed at streamlining your travel experience. The ticket office is open from early morning until past midnight on most days, ensuring you can pick up or purchase tickets conveniently. With ticket machines available, there's no need to worry if you're in a rush—they're ready to serve your needs around the clock. Plus, if you're carrying a smartcard, the station has validators to expedite your journey.

To further enhance your journey, Ormskirk station provides accessible facilities, including step-free access across the station and induction loops to assist those with hearing impairments. Though there are no accessible ticket machines, support is readily available from staff and help points. Notably, customer service help and information are robust, with options for both departure and arrival screens and clear announcements to guide you.

Facilities at Alderley Edge Station

The station provides essential facilities for travelers, ensuring a comfortable journey. The ticket office operates from early morning until early afternoon on Saturdays, though it remains closed during weekdays and Sundays. However, you can still purchase tickets or collect pre-purchased tickets from the accessible ticket machines located on-site. It's worth noting that smartcards are supported at the station, aligning with modern, streamlined travel conveniences.

For those with specific accessibility needs, Alderley Edge station offers partial step-free access and is categorized as a scooter-friendly location, making it navigable for those using mobility aids. There's no waiting room available, yet the station ensures passenger security with the presence of CCTV. Unfortunately, facilities such as restrooms, baby changing rooms, and refreshment outlets are not provided, so plan accordingly.
